Papua New Guinea to Albania: Complete Plug & Adapter Guide (2026) Adapter Needed
Traveling from Papua New Guinea to Albania means crossing into a different electrical system. Before you leave, take a moment to understand the plug types and voltage used in Albania so you can keep all your devices charged and ready.
The plug types are different between these two countries. In Papua New Guinea, outlets accept Type I, but in Albania you'll find Type C/F sockets. A travel plug adapter is essential for this trip.
On the voltage front, Papua New Guinea (240V, 50Hz) and Albania (230V, 50Hz) are very similar. You shouldn't need a voltage converter for your electronics.
